Google Apps Script

Материал из cryptofutures.trading
Версия от 14:55, 14 марта 2025; Admin (обсуждение | вклад) (@pipegas_WP)
(разн.) ← Предыдущая версия | Текущая версия (разн.) | Следующая версия → (разн.)
Перейти к навигации Перейти к поиску

Google Apps Script для новичков в торговле криптофьючерсами

Google Apps Script (GAS) — это платформа для написания программного кода, интегрированная с сервисами Google, таких как Google Sheets, Google Drive и Google Calendar. Она позволяет автоматизировать рутинные задачи, создавать скрипты для анализа данных и взаимодействовать с внешними API, включая API бирж криптовалют. Для трейдеров Криптофьючерсы GAS становится мощным инструментом для Автоматизация торговли, Анализ рыночной капитализации, Мониторинг рынка криптовалют и реализации Стратегии торговли криптофьючерсами.

Основы Google Apps Script

    • Что такое GAS?**

GAS — это платформа на основе языка JavaScript, которая позволяет писать скрипты для автоматизации задач в экосистеме Google. Например, можно создать скрипт, который: - Собирает данные с Binance или BitMEX через их API. - Рассчитывает Технический анализ индикаторы в реальном времени. - Формирует Уведомления в торговле по email при достижении определенных условий.

    • Как начать?**

1. Создайте Google Sheets-таблицу. 2. Откройте вкладку: Меню > «Скрипты» > «Создать проект». 3. Начните писать код в Google Cloud Platform-консоли.

    • Преимущества для трейдеров:**

- Бесплатное использование для базовых скриптов. - Простота интеграции с Google Sheets для визуализации данных. - Возможность запуска скриптов по расписанию (через Таймеры).

Применение в торговле криптофьючерсами

        1. 1. Получение данных с бирж

С помощью функции UrlFetchApp.fetch() можно получить данные через API бирж (например, Bybit API или OKX API). Пример кода:

```javascript function getBTCPrice() {

 var url = "https://api.bitmex.com/api/v1/instrument?symbol=XBTUSD";  
 var response = UrlFetchApp.fetch(url);  
 var data = JSON.parse(response.getContentText());  
 return data.closePrice;  

} ```

    • Связанные темы:**

- API бирж криптовалют - REST API - WebSocket API

        1. 2. Автоматизация стратегий

GAS подходит для простых Алгоритмическая торговля стратегий, например: - Возобновление тренда (reaking to moving averages). - Стратегии High-Frequency Trading (HFT).

```javascript function checkStopLoss() {

 var sheet = SpreadsheetApp.getActiveSheet();  
 var currentPrice = getBTCPrice();  
 if (currentPrice < sheet.getRange("B2").getValue()) {  
   MailApp.sendEmail("[email protected]", "Stop Loss Triggered!", "Price dropped below " + sheet.getRange("B2").getValue());  
 }  

} ```

        1. 3. Анализ объема и Технический анализ

Интеграция данных о Объем торговли на криптобиржах с индикаторами (например, RSI, MACD) позволяет выявлять Трендовые стратегии.

Инструмент Описание Применение в GAS
RSI Индикатор перекупленности/перепроданности Расчет в Google Sheets с помощью формулы или скрипта
Объем Анализ объема торгов для подтверждения Тренд Визуализация в таблицах и триггеры уведомлений
    • Связанные темы:**

- Анализ корреляции активов - Кластерный анализ рынка - Волатильность криптовалют

Примеры скриптов для трейдеров

        1. Скрипт для мониторинга Мувинг

```javascript function calculateSMA() {

 var sheet = SpreadsheetApp.getActiveSheet();  
 var data = sheet.getRange("A2:A101").getValues(); // Цены за 100 периодов  
 var sum = data.reduce((a, b) => a + b[0], 0);  
 var sma = sum / data.length;  
 sheet.getRange("B102").setValue(sma);  

} ```

        1. Автоматическая отправка отчетов

```javascript function sendTradeReport() {

 var sheet = SpreadsheetApp.getActiveSpreadsheet();  
 var report = sheet.getSheetByName("Отчет");  
 MailApp.sendEmail({  
   to: "[email protected]",  
   subject: "Ежедневный отчет",  
   body: "Просмотрите Google Sheets: " + sheet.getUrl(),  
   name: "Торговый бот"  
 });  

} ```

Безопасность и ограничения

    • Ограничения GAS:**

- Ограничения API: лимиты на количество запросов (например, 20 вызовов UrlFetchApp.fetch() в минуту). - Бесплатный тарифный план недостаточен для High-Frequency Trading.

    • Рекомендации по безопасности:**

- Используйте Безопасность на криптобиржах: API-ключи с ограниченным доступом. - Защитите скрипты паролями через OAuth2.0.

Рекомендации для новичков

1. Начните с Обучение программированию на JavaScript и Google Sheets-формул. 2. Изучите документацию: Документация Google Apps Script. 3. Используйте Backtesting стратегий в Google Sheets перед внедрением в реальные Торговые операции.

    • Совет:**

Объедините GAS с TradingView для Визуализация данных и Мани-менеджмент (через Webhook-интеграцию).

Заключение

Google Apps Script — это доступный инструмент для новичков, желающих автоматизировать Торговля фьючерсами криптовалют. Он идеально подходит для анализа Объем и Цена в реальном времени, создания Стратегии криптофьючерсов и снижения Рисков.

Рекомендуем также изучить: - Автоматизация торговли криптовалютами - Анализ рыночной капитализации - Программирование для трейдеров


Рекомендуемые платформы для фьючерсов

Платформа Особенности фьючерсов Регистрация
Binance Futures Плечо до 125x, контракты USDⓈ-M Зарегистрироваться сейчас
Bybit Futures Обратные бессрочные контракты Начать торговлю
BingX Futures Копировальная торговля фьючерсами Присоединиться к BingX
Bitget Futures Контракты с маржой USDT Открыть счет
BitMEX Crypto Trading Platform up to 100x leverage - спот торговля со 100х плечом BitMEX

Присоединяйтесь к сообществу

Подпишитесь на Telegram-канал @strategybin для получения дополнительной информации. Самая прибыльная криптоплатформа - зарегистрируйтесь здесь.

Участвуйте в нашем сообществе

Подпишитесь на Telegram-канал @cryptofuturestrading для анализа, бесплатных сигналов и многого другого!